Fed independence

The law that established the Federal Reserve says it cannot be removed from the “cause”, but it does not specify the term and does not create removal procedures. No president has ever removed the ruler of the Federal Reserve, and the law was not tested in the court.

COB said on Tuesday that the public’s interest in the independence of the Federal Reserve from political coercion was weighing in favor of maintaining cooking in the federal reserve during the continuation of the case.

She said that the best reading of the law is that it is not permissible to remove the ruler of the Federal Reserve Bank except for misconduct while they are in office. Calls against the mortgage against Cook are all related to the measures they have taken before the US Senate confirmation in 2022.

Trump and William Polly, director of the Federal Housing Agency appointed by the president, said that Cook was inaccurately described three separate real estate for mortgage requests, which may allow them to obtain lower interest rates and tax credits.

The Ministry of Justice has also launched an investigation to defraud the real estate mortgage in Cook and issued the summons of the major jury from both Georgia and Michigan, according to the documents that Reuters watched and a source familiar with the matter.
